Sen. Richard Lugar, (R-IN) has told President Bush that striking Iran is not an option to explore right now, and urges high level talks between the two countries to see if some sort of diplomatic solution can be reached.

He said "I believe we ought to cool it when it comes to possible use of force against Iran. We need to make more headway diplomatically". He said we ought to hold off on sanctions until they can be proven to be effective.

But Nicholas Burns, the number 3 man at the State Dept. says if Iran continues on its path of no return, it will find itself "in a box", and in a position it doesn't want ot be in.
